🦅 Digital Content Marketing Manager at Ravenpay Limited

Ravenpay Limited is a distinguished FinTech leader committed to revolutionising financial accessibility across Africa. The company's core mission is to construct a robust financial ecosystem where every African is empowered with swift, dependable, and highly personalised financial tools. This commitment drives innovation and growth within the organisation.


📍 Job Details


🎯 Job Overview

Ravenpay Limited is actively seeking a creative, strategic, and meticulously detail-oriented Digital Content Marketing Manager to take ownership of its entire content marketing portfolio.

The successful candidate will be tasked with the end-to-end planning, creation, and distribution of valuable, highly relevant, and consistent content. The primary objective is to strategically attract and retain a clearly defined target audience, ultimately driving profitable customer actions that align with the company's financial and brand growth objectives. This role demands a holistic approach to content that integrates brand narrative with data-driven performance.


🔑 Key Responsibilities

The Digital Content Marketing Manager will be responsible for the following core areas:

Content Strategy & Planning

  • Developing and executing a comprehensive content strategy that is intrinsically aligned with Ravenpay Limited's brand identity, audience segmentation, and overarching marketing goals.
  • Conducting regular content audits and gap analyses to proactively identify opportunities for new, high-impact content and the optimisation of existing assets.
  • Defining quantifiable Content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and delivering rigorous reporting on performance metrics on a consistent basis.

Content Creation & Management

  • Managing the entire content creation workflow, including initial ideation, professional writing, meticulous editing, design coordination, and final publishing across all platforms.
  • Creating and overseeing the production of a diverse range of marketing collateral, which includes, but is not limited to: high-quality blog posts, engaging newsletters, optimised social media updates, comprehensive website copy, impactful case studies, compelling video scripts, and authoritative white papers.
  • Collaborating cross-functionally with internal and external writers, designers, and video producers to ensure a unified brand voice and consistent quality in all published material.

SEO & Content Optimisation

  • Optimising all content assets for robust Search Engine Optimisation (SEO) and enhanced readability, working closely with specialist SEO teams to dramatically increase search engine visibility.
  • Maintaining up-to-date knowledge of relevant keyword trends and algorithmic changes to proactively adjust content plans and ensure maximum relevance and search ranking potential.

Audience & Market Insights

  • Gaining a deep understanding of the target audience's needs, motivations, behaviours, and preferences through diligent market research and advanced data analytics.
  • Remaining current on industry trends, FinTech developments, and competitor content strategies to maintain Ravenpay Limited's content relevance, competitive edge, and differentiation in the market.

Team & Workflow Management

  • Managing detailed content calendars to ensure the timely delivery of all assets and perfect alignment with major marketing campaigns and product launch schedules.
  • Coordinating extensively with the product, sales, and design teams to gather essential insights, subject matter expertise, and content requirements.
  • Supervising and mentoring freelance writers, editors, or junior content creators, as required, to scale the content operation effectively.

🤝 Qualifications and Experience

Candidates should possess the necessary relevant professional and academic qualifications for a senior marketing role.

  • A comprehensive working knowledge of SEO principles, major content analytics tools (e.g., Google Analytics, SEMrush, Ahrefs), and enterprise-level Content Management Systems (CMS) such as WordPress or Webflow.
  • Proven experience in managing content for social media channels and email marketing campaigns.
  • 3 to 5 years of verified professional experience in senior content marketing, editorial, or related strategic communication roles.
  • Exceptional professional writing, editing, and strategic storytelling skills with a portfolio to match.
  • Strong project management and organisational skills with an emphasis on efficient resource allocation and timely delivery.

📩 How to Apply

Interested and qualified candidates are invited to submit their Curriculum Vitae (CV) to: careers@raven.africa (cc: marketing@getravenbank.com).

Applicants must use the specific title Digital Content Marketing Manager as the subject of the email to ensure proper processing.

Note: Only candidates who are shortlisted for the interview process will be contacted.

Application Deadline: 30th November, 2025.
